Pricing:
- Free: Unlimited users, 100MB storage, basic features
- Unlimited ($7/seat/month): Unlimited storage, integrations, dashboards
- Business ($12/seat/month): Google SSO, custom automations, workload management
- Enterprise: Custom pricing, white labelling, managed support

ClickUp packs more features than any other PM tool in this price range:
Task Management
- Unlimited task nesting (subtasks of subtasks)
- Custom fields: text, number, dropdown, date, formula, relationship
- Dependencies and blockers
- Priority levels and status customisation per list
Views (15+ types)
- List, Board (Kanban), Table, Calendar, Gantt/Timeline
- Workload view for capacity planning
- Mind Map, Chat, Whiteboard, Form, Map
Built-in Tools
- Docs: Full-featured document editor inside tasks
- Whiteboards: Visual brainstorming connected to tasks
- Time tracking: Log hours per task, view timesheets
- Goals: OKR tracking tied to tasks and metrics
- Dashboards: Custom reporting with 50+ widget types
Automation
ClickUp's automation is powerful on paid tiers — build multi-step if/then workflows without code. Trigger automations based on status changes, due dates, field updates, or form submissions.
Pros and Cons
Pros:
- Unbeatable value — more features per dollar than any competitor
- Truly flexible: adapts to how your team works
- Free plan is genuinely useful (not a stripped demo)
- Active development — new features ship weekly
- Works for engineering, marketing, HR, ops, and more
Cons:
- Steep learning curve — plan 2–4 weeks for full team adoption
- Mobile app lags behind the desktop experience
- Occasional performance issues with very large workspaces
- "Feature bloat" can overwhelm new users

ClickUp is an excellent choice for:
- Agencies and consultants: Manage multiple clients with custom views per project
- Software teams: Build sprints, track bugs, manage product backlogs
- Operations teams: Run SOP workflows, onboarding, and process management
- Remote teams: Replace multiple tools with one connected workspace
ClickUp is a poor choice for:
- Teams that want something that "just works" without configuration
- Non-technical users who will be frustrated by option overload
- Very simple workflows (use Trello instead)
